The principles of pink noise and white noise commonly develop in conversations regarding sleep quality. Both are types of acoustic wave patterns that are frequently used to assist sleep, each having special features and impacts. White noise is a consistent noise that covers a large range of frequencies, much like the fixed noise from a tv or radio. It can mask background noises, which can be beneficial for people who stay in settings with regular disruptions. On the other hand, pink noise, while also a regular noise, has a more well balanced set of regularities that lower in intensity as the regularity increases. This can develop a more comforting auditory experience, often compared to the mild sound of rainfall or wind. Some studies also recommend that pink noise might result in improved sleep top quality by promoting much deeper sleep stages, which can be specifically attractive for those attempting to boost their nightly remainder.
Despite these sound strategies being valuable for lots of people, one common complaint is experiencing headaches after naps. This phenomenon can perplex and discourage those intending to gain the rejuvenating benefits of brief daytime rests. There can be several reasons for this post-nap headache. One potential reason is connected to sleep inertia, which refers to the grogginess and disorientation experienced after awakening from sleep. If a nap is as well long or takes place in a deep sleep stage, the abrupt change to wakefulness can cause headaches. An additional aspect might be dehydration or a decrease in blood sugar levels otherwise enough water or food is eaten prior to the nap. Tension and stress in the neck and shoulder area throughout the nap can likewise bring about muscle-induced headaches. Moreover, for some people, sleeping can interrupt the overall sleep-wake cycle, making it much more challenging to attain undisturbed nighttime sleep, which can lead to headaches also. Therefore, comprehending one's body and its one-of-a-kind response to napping is vital in creating a sleep technique that makes best use of rest without unfavorable impacts.

In discussions of sleep cycles, the 90-minute sleep cycle is a pivotal concept for sleep enthusiasts and those looking for a far better understanding of their remainder patterns. Human sleep typically progresses through a number of phases throughout the evening, and one complete cycle commonly lasts around 90 minutes. Within this cycle, individuals move with light sleep, deep sleep, and REM sleep. Recognizing this cyclical nature enables individuals to time their sleep successfully, maximizing just how they really feel upon waking. The vital to getting up freshened usually lies in aligning wake-up minutes with the end of these sleep cycles. Therefore, individuals aiming to awaken feeling rejuvenated need to consider timing their sleep or naps in 90-minute increments.
For those looking to calculate their sleep cycles successfully, a 90-minute sleep cycle calculator can be a useful tool. By allowing users to make these computations, they can better navigate via their sleeping patterns, guaranteeing they do not wake during deep sleep phases, which can lead to grogginess and headaches.
